Mountain Summit Gear Horizon Cot

The Mountain Summit Gear Horizon Cot is our top budget choice is a great option for campers who want an easy solution to sleep. It's simple to set up and transport and is comfortable to sleep on. The cot's wide, large base can hold people who are up to 6 feet tall and 300 lbs. Our test subjects found that it was sturdy on most terrains. It has a pocket on the side to store items such as sleeping pads, water bottles, and phones. While it's bulkier than some backpacking cots however, the Mountain Summit Gear Horizon Cot is still a great option for portable storage and fits well into most car camping tents.

Helinox Light Cot

Helinox Cot One Convertible combines high-end engineered fabric with non-stretch technology to create an ultra-lightweight camp bed that is durable and comfortable. The patented tensioners eliminate the need for bulky crossbars and braces and provide excellent tension to the bed's surface without adding additional weight. They also prevent the cot from flattening when it's placed on uneven ground. The only drawback to this model is its price.

There are a variety of budget-friendly options for backpackers with a budget. The OEX Ultralite Folding Cot, for example, costs less than half the cost of the Helinox Lite Cot while being considerably heavier. The major drawback of the OEX is that it's not as straightforward to assemble and can be difficult for smaller-framed people to bend its five aluminum leg assemblies to fit.

Helinox Lite Cots come with unique tensioning systems that include a lever lock, which makes them simpler to assemble and disassemble. The lever is situated on the opposite side of each leg. It has an arm pivoting that connects with the top frame bar. The other end of the lever is a tab that is compressed and is pressed to release it. This system makes use of mechanical leverage to create great tension to the bed without adding bulk or stress to the legs.

The Lite Cot can also be adjusted to a different height using the leg extensions that come with it. This is very helpful for camping in an alpine setting where you'll have to get off the ground due to snow or uneven terrain. However, the low-profile of this cot can be a problem if a big mover during the night or when sharing your tent with another.

The Lite Cot is no different. It takes a bit of practice to put it together and then disassemble it. But after a few uses, it becomes a breeze to use and pack up. It's also extremely light and compact for a cot and fits in most cars and vans with their gear packed. This makes it a great choice for bike or car camping.

ALPS Mountaineering ReadyLite Cot

The ALPS Mountaineering ReadyLite Cot makes a great option if you are looking for a lightweight, easy-to-pack and set-up backpacking cot. The cot is light and durable due to its 7000 series aluminum frame and 420D honeycomb polyester rip-stop material. It weighs less than 5 pounds, but can support 300 pounds of weight. It can be folded into an a7x17 inch carry bag that makes it simple to carry.

The ALPS ReadyLite Cot is unlike other cheap cots, which require you to spread it out from the middle. Instead, its legs extend out at the bottom of each side. This means that all you have to do is spread the cot out and tighten the straps. It was easy to set up. However its bigger size might not be suitable for some tents.

Although the ALPS Mountaineering ReadyLite isn't as portable as some of the other cots on this list, it's still the most affordable option for backpackers who need a bed. Plus, its large feet at the base of each leg swivel to adapt to uneven terrain and even let you sleep in the rain.
